Jacob Two Two was a set of stories I read as a child. He was a boy who said every thing twice because no one would listen to him. It eventually became habit and a habit that got him into trouble with those who did listen.

I found some info out on it though and found that if I do not rest my hand while using the mouse but instead hover it over the mouse it's fine. When I'm fone doing something to look at it a moment I rest my hand in my lap. I found just by doing this it's gotten better.

I rest my elbow on a chair back to give me some hight when using the mouse to instead of hoding it up for a long time..

The ideas is to pretty much not rest your wrist on anything as it simply dammages it more..
